About Nikkia Matthews

Nikkia Matthews is a Licensed Master Social Worker (LMSW) with 11 years of clinical experience who focuses on helping adolescents, young adults, couples and families navigate transitions and heal from difficult experiences. She works with clients on relationship exploration and pre-marital counseling, as well as women’s issues, family conflicts and life adjustment concerns. Her practice includes care for trauma-related difficulties and symptoms such as anxiety, depression, PTSD and the stresses that come with major life changes.

Matthews emphasizes a collaborative partnership with each person she sees, combining a hands-on, holistic perspective with practical skill building. She draws on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T), Family Systems Theory, Strength-Based Therapy and Solution-Focused Therapy, and integrates expressive art and music-inspired techniques to support emotional processing and personal growth. Her approach aims to address emotional, behavioral and practical needs together so clients can build the tools needed for daily life.

Clients can expect a focus on uncovering and reconciling past wounds, resolving interpersonal conflict, and developing new patterns that support well-being. Matthews frames therapy as a journey of learning and change, and she is committed to walking alongside people as they develop skills and perspectives that help them move forward.

Could Remote Therapy Be a Good Fit?

Many people wonder if therapy delivered remotely can truly help. For a wide range of common concerns - including stress, anxiety, depression, relationship challenges and navigating life changes - research indicates online therapy can be as effective as traditional in-person sessions.

One key advantage is flexibility. Individuals can connect with therapists in the format that works best for them - through video calls, phone sessions, live chat or in-app messaging - which can make it easier to fit care into a busy schedule or to access support from home.

Therapists are licensed professionals, and people can choose or change their therapist if they want a different therapeutic fit. For many, online therapy offers a practical and effective route to find consistent support and make meaningful progress.
